Shearwave elastography of the knee menisci
Abstract Objectives: Sonoelastography is a relatively new technique used to evaluate the musculoskeletal system, but shear wave elastography of the knee menisci has not previously been reported. The purpose of this study is to study sonoelastographic features of the knee menisci. Methods: 34 knee joints were studied, in 17 healthy subjects. Shear wave elastography was used to evaluate the anterior horn of the medial meniscus. Normal sonoelastographic values were obtained. Results: The mean shear elastic modulus of the anterior horn of the right medial meniscus was 24.86 kPa (range 15.3- 36.1 ±6.35 SD), and 23.86 kPa (range14.6-37.6 ± 4.49 SD) for the anterior horn of the left medial meniscus. Inverse correlation was noted between the right medial meniscus elasticity and height. Inverse correlation was noted between the left medial meniscus elasticity and age, while positive correlation was noted between left medial meniscus elasticity and BMI. Conclusion: The elastic modulus of the knee menisci has been determined in healthy subjects and can serve as a reference when studying pathological conditions of these structures .
